  1. Geni World Family Tree, via https://www.myheritage.com/research/reco...
    Narcissa Edwards (born Shipp)<br>Gender: Female<br>Birth: June 1781<br>Death: May 19 1860 - Andrew County, Missouri, United States<br>Father: <a>Richard Jonathan Shipp<br>Mother: Elizabeth Shipp (born Doniphan)<br>Husband: John Edwards<br>Child: <a>Wiley Edwards<br>Siblings: Mary Shipp, Elizabeth Doniphan "Betsey" Shipp, Thomas Shipp, John G. Shipp, Richard Doniphan Shipp (born Ship), Unknown Shipp, Sophia Sebree (born Shipp), Emma Grant Truman (born Shipp), Son Unknown, Edmund Shipp, Anderson Doniphan Shipp
